Web15 dec. 2024 · Kucios is the traditional Christmas Eve dinner in Lithuania, held on the 24th of December. The meal is a family occasion which includes many traditions of both pagan and Christian origin. http://lnkc.lt/eknygos/eka/customs/christmas.html Web23 jul. 2024 · Lithuanian Tree Cake Is Made on a Steel Rod. An egg-rich batter is dripped in stages onto a stainless-steel rod or spit that rotates over a heat source. As the speed is increased, the batter forms spikes that resemble the branches of a tree. A cross-section of the cake also resembles the rings of a tree trunk, hence its name.

Web13 aug. 2024 · Wild mushroom picking is a big tradition in the country every autumn and there are thought to be over 400 varieties found in Lithuanian forests. People head out with their baskets to collect a hoard to keep in their pantry. To preserve them, people usually dry them out and then reuse them throughout the winter.
